Why Pediatric Genomics Is Reshaping Childhood Health
Modern families, fitness professionals, educators, wellness experts, and healthcare organizations all share one priority — making the most informed decisions possible for the children in their care. Pediatric genomics delivers exactly that. It is the comprehensive analysis of a child’s DNA to uncover predispositions, metabolic patterns, fitness traits, and health risks that shape everything from how they respond to food to how their body processes medication.
According to the University of Utah Health, one in five children admitted to level 4 neonatal intensive care units are there due to genetic diseases. Early genomic identification does not just improve outcomes — it saves lives. But the value of pediatric genomics extends far beyond critical care, transforming everyday wellness decisions for families worldwide.

6. Precision Medicine and Pediatric Pharmacogenomics
Children are not small adults — their bodies process medications differently, and those differences are encoded in their DNA. The NIH confirms that pharmacogenomic testing improves dosing strategies specifically for children, reducing adverse reactions and increasing treatment precision.
